Abstract
The article deals with the poet and statesmen who lived and worked in Khorezm in the XIV-XX centuries, investigates the scientific activity of the Orientalists, who studied the cultural life of this historical epoch. The findings of rare manuscripts reflected in the works of A.N. Samoylovich are summarized and given real facts about literary environment.
